What is Micro-Self Care?

Micro-self care refers to small and simple activities or practices that you can engage in to promote your physical, emotional and mental well-being. These activities can be easily integrated into one’s daily routine and do not require a significant amount of time or effort. Examples of micro-self care practices include taking a short walk, drinking a glass of water, taking a few deep breaths, practicing gratitude, or doing a quick stretch.

Engaging in micro-self care practices can have several benefits, including:

  1. Increased energy and productivity: Taking a short break to engage in a micro-self care activity can help to refresh and reenergise you, leading to increased focus and productivity.
  2. Improved mood and emotional well-being: Simple self-care practices like taking a few deep breaths or practicing gratitude can help to reduce stress, promote relaxation and improve overall mood and emotional well-being.
  3. Enhanced physical health: Engaging in physical micro-self care practices such as stretching or taking a short walk can help to reduce muscle tension, improve flexibility and promote overall physical health.
  4. Reduced stress and anxiety: Micro-self care practices can help to reduce stress and anxiety levels, which can have a positive impact on both physical and emotional health.

Integrating micro-self care practices into one’s daily routine can lead to improved well-being and increased resilience in the face of life’s challenges.
